Help To Buy Forces Scheme Lands At Linden Homes' Victory Fields
10 Jun 2014

Military families in the Cotswolds hoping to get on the property ladder need look no further than Linden Homes’ Victory Fields development in Upper Rissington, where the government-backed Forces Help to Buy scheme is giving people a step up.

Just over 11 miles from RAF Brize Norton, the largest RAF station in the UK, the popular collection of family houses promises a thriving neighbourhood complete with a new primary school, a village square, a local shop and plenty of green space.

Victory Fields’ three, four and five bedroom properties have already caught the attention of service personnel who have the added incentive of now being able to borrow up to 50 per cent of their annual salary interest free under Forces Help to Buy.

Designed to assist more military families own their own home, the scheme allows qualifying buyers to borrow up to a maximum of £25,000. It can be used towards a deposit and other costs such as solicitor’s and estate agent’s fees.

In fact, Victory Fields has a unique RAF pedigree which extends beyond its proximity to Brize Norton. The site was formerly RAF Rissington and is near the former base of the world famous Red Arrows air display team.

The Heritage Collection is another example: one of the former military buildings is being handsomely brought back to life as a pair of three-bedroom single-storey homes and a trio of four-bedroom homes.

Some of the home styles have even been named after aircraft chosen by local pupils in a school competition: Buckingham, Hawker and Whitworth.

It’s all helped put the high quality homes on the list for many of the 7,000-plus service personnel, contractors and civilian staff members who work at Brize Norton, home to the UK's Strategic and Tactical Air Transport and Air-to-Air Refuelling forces.

The new community of over 300 homes commands outstanding views across the rolling landscape and will feature a proposed public house, gym and nursery, as well as a scattering of play areas, wildlife ponds and tennis courts. Nearby villages include Stow-on-the-Wold and Bourton-on-the-Water.

Travelling to and from Victory Fields is straightforward – main roads link to the motorway network giving access to the M40, the M4 and the M5. The nearest train station is at Kingham, from where services can reach London Paddington in about an hour and a half. The nearest international airports are Birmingham and London Heathrow.
